They are both S4 you don't need to swap the wiring either.Just swap the engines.And use your NA flywheel and clutch so your starter still works.It should run just like that

if you have a t2 and na on hand you have all the parts, while you're swapping parts why not keep the turboii trans and friends.
you'd have to swap flywheels with the na... and you'll probably break the na trans, who can resist driving a turbo car hard. since you have the donor cars you have a nice opportunity to do it 'right'. |
